Transaction 501e8a59b5cf4f40b5ac96e34bc70645e53d190a891c05c82bd4e95b51e5995c

7 Input
1 Outputs
  • 501e8a59b5cf4f40b5ac96e34bc70645e53d190a891c05c82bd4e95b51e5995c:0
  • value  79329883
    address  3NAsffMhLDFuZQoM9aNkLmbV6fBWEGepDi